USB C Power Converter, DC 7.9 x 0.9mm Input to USB-C 100W PD Emulator Trigger Charging Cable

Convert a compatible DC power supply with a 7.9 x 0.9mm plug into a USB-C Power Delivery (PD) output with this compact USB-C power converter featuring a PD emulator/trigger. Built for up to 100W, it enables supported USB-C devices to negotiate the required PD profile (subject to the converter’s programmed profiles and the capacity of the connected DC supply), making it ideal for service kits, IT benches, portable power setups, and AV installations.

The unit takes DC 7.9 x 0.9mm input and outputs power via the integrated USB-C lead, helping you repurpose existing power bricks or DC sources as a PD-capable supply. Many versions also include an auxiliary USB-A port for low-power accessories, providing added flexibility for peripherals.

To ensure correct operation, verify:

  • The DC adapter provides the required voltage/current for the converter and intended load.

  • Your USB-C device supports the PD profile being presented by the emulator/trigger.

  • Total draw stays within the 100W maximum rating.
